Ardrossan South Beach train station provides comprehensive amenities designed to ensure a comfortable journey.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with a ticket office open from early morning until evening throughout the week. Alternatively, passengers can utilize ticket machines that are conveniently located and accessible, ensuring that collecting tickets purchased online is a breeze. The station also features smartcard validators, though it does not issue smartcards.
From a customer service perspective, help points are available for travelers seeking information and assistance, further supported by staff presence during operating hours. Screens displaying departure and arrival times, along with announcements, keep passengers informed. Notably, the station is equipped with CCTV for increased security.
The station is committed to accessibility, featuring step-free access throughout the premises. It is categorized as a Category A station, indicative of its single-platform setup with the meeting point situated at the ticket office. Accessible ticket machines and a ramp for train access ensure those with mobility impairments are catered for. However, accessible toilets are unavailable and those with particular needs should plan accordingly.
As for vehicular access, parking facilities operate around the clock with 24 spaces available, one of which is designated for accessible use. Daily parking charges apply, yet the stations' proximity to key routes makes it a convenient option for those driving in from out of town.
Connectivity from Ardrossan South Beach station is robust, providing varied transport links that seamlessly blend into your travel itinerary. Bus services make stops directly outside the station, while taxis can be summoned through resources like TrainTaxi for more bespoke journeys.
For detailed bus service information, Traveline Scotland offers essential scheduling and route data. Rail replacement services are also operational as needed, affording peace of mind during planned maintenance or service disruptions.

Understanding the potential needs of its patrons, Reading Station furnishes extensive facilities. The ticket office operates from morning to night, opening from 06:15 to 22:00 during we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:15 to 22:00 on Sundays. In addition, ticket machines are plentiful, and most importantly, accessible ticket machines are conveniently located for easy access. Reading Station also facilitates smart card validation, boasts an induction loop, and is reinforced with round-the-clock CCTV.
Accessibility, naturally, is a top priority here. The station provides step-free access throughout its vast span, making platforms easily reachable via lifts and bridges. Furthermore, acc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and seating areas are maintained to high standards, ensuring comfort for everyone.
Shopping and dining options are abundant. Refreshment facilities, cash machines, and a selection of shops await travelers. Free public Wi-Fi adds to the comfort, making it easier to continue working or stay entertained while on the move.
Getting to your next destination is seamless with Reading Station's diverse travel connections. Taxi ranks are readily available at both station entrances, ensuring even those with accessibility needs are well-catered to. Buses, too, are nearby, although travelers should note that not all are accessible. For those traveling further afield, frequent connections to both Heathrow and Gatwick Airports are offered, with a luxurious 'RailAir' service to Heathrow and regular trains to Gatwick.
Meanwhile, cyclists can take advantage of plentiful bicycle storage options, although there's no hire facility at the station itself.
